Output 6a39ae96fac1004b20c5a60a3b4859422e1f370b19997b3613043516fa0b8986:0

value
38705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99ae93172b96fef8d027e34e3115aee5223fbaff OP_EQUAL
address
3FhcSYir2H5sQdY6M1QkijGqyDSpqKXb9R
transaction
6a39ae96fac1004b20c5a60a3b4859422e1f370b19997b3613043516fa0b8986
spent
true